Chris Bedi, Chief Digital Information Officer for ServiceNow talks to the power of platforms to unlock digital acceleration. This presentation includes live demos of the ServiceNow platform functionalities illustrating how it supports experience, speed, and AI. Chris is joined by Venice Goodwine, CIO, Department of the Air Force, who talked about how she’s used ServiceNow to build a “coalition of the willing” to transform how IT is managed and how work gets done within the Air Force.

Featured Speakers:

  • Steve Walters, Senior Vice President and General Manager, Public Sector, ServiceNow
  • Chris Bedi, Chief Digital Information Officer, ServiceNow
  • Venice Goodwine, Chief Information Officer, Department of the Air Force
